Explain Title IV Regulation A+ for me | Manhattan Street Capital

Title IV Regulation A+, sometimes referred to as Reg A+, is a rule that allows private companies to raise capital from the public. It offers a simplified process compared to traditional initial public offerings (IPOs). Under this system, companies can offer their securities to a broad range of investors, including both accredited and non-accredited investors. This Regulation Operates with Crowdfunding Equity

Regulation A+, also known as Reg A+, is a unique tool within the United States securities laws that allows companies to raise capital through a system called equity crowdfunding. Under Regulation A+, companies can offer and sell their securities to the general public. It's a regulated pathway for businesses to tap into a wider pool of investors. A key benefit of Regulation A+ is that it provides companies with the chance to raise significant amounts of capital, up to fifty million dollars, without requiring the same stringent obligations as traditional initial public offerings (IPOs).

Additionally, Regulation A+ offers investors a chance to invest in promising companies at an early stage, potentially achieving attractive returns. However, it's important for both companies and investors to understand the provisions of Regulation A+ before engaging in this type of crowdfunding.

The Securities and Exchange Commission

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ission is an independent body of the U.S. government. It's chief function is to oversee the stock industry and safeguard investors. The SEC fulfills this mission by upholding federal securities laws, delivering investors with trustworthy information, and fostering fair and orderly markets.

  • {The SEC'sauthority encompasses a broad variety of financial instruments, including equities, fixed income, investment funds, and derivatives.
  • {The agency also regulates{ investment advisers, broker-dealers, and other market participants.
  • {To ensure compliance with federal securities laws, the SEC conducts investigations, brings legal charges, and imposes penalties.

Regulation A+ Offerings | Reg A+ Rules | Regulation A+ Crowdfunding Capital Raising

The JOBS Act has introduced a new avenue for companies to raise capital via Reg A+ offerings. This regulation provides a streamlined path for companies to go public, making it more accessible than traditional IPOs. Regulation A+, also known as "mini-IPO," allows companies to raise up to $75 million from both accredited and unaccredited investors through a public offering.

Reg A+ Issuers can utilize Crowdfunding Platforms to enable these raises on their platform. The SEC has approved new "Reg A+" rules for Capital Raising, differentiating it from other methods like Regulation D, which primarily caters to accredited investors.

There are distinct differences between Reg A+ and Regulation D. Regulation D, particularly Rule 506(b) and 506(c), offers more flexibility for companies seeking to raise capital privately, but typically involves stricter eligibility requirements. Conversely, Reg A+ mandates greater Transparency due to its public nature.

While Regulation A+ presents Funding an attractive alternative to traditional IPOs, it's crucial for Issuers to understand the specific Requirements associated with this offering type. Consulting with experts in securities law and financial Advisors is highly recommended.
